The Cyrus Cylinder
Submitted by Rasputin Paracelsus on Fri, 05/01/2007 - 17:03. Mesopotamia | PersiaThe Cyrus Cylinder, discovered in 1879 and now in the British Museum, is a cuneiform document in the shape of a small barrel, commissioned by Cyrus the Great of Persia.
A certain amount of fraudulent material exists on the internet, for example that it confirms what the Bible says (Isaiah 44.23-45.8; Ezra 1.1-6, 6.1-5; 2 Chronicles 36.22-23): that in 539 BCE, the Persian conqueror Cyrus the Great had allowed the Jews to return from their Babylonian Exile.
